Description
'Procap 80 Wdg' is a fungicide.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 70506-445. It was originally approved by EPA on 13 Oct 1994. It has a 'Danger'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: Captan. It's approved for 44 sites including almonds, apples, apricots, azalea, begonia, blackberries, blueberries, camellia, carnation, and cherries. It is also approved for 107 pests and pest groups including but not limited to anthracnose, berry rot, bitter rot, black pox, black rot, black rot of grapes, black rot/frogeye leaf spot, black spot, black spot of rose, and blights.
